4. The tribunal allowed the application of Syed on the short ground that the Departmental Promotion Committee which met on October 28, 1987 acted illegally in adopting the "sealed cover" procedure. Relying upon the judgment of this Court in Union of India v. K.V. Jankiraman and Ors. the tribunal came to the conclusion that "sealed cover" procedure could be adopted only after the date of issuance of charge-sheet, that being the date from which disciplinary proceedings could be taken to have been initiated. Since in this case, admittedly, on the date when the DPC met the charge sheet had not been served on Syed, resort could not be had to the "sealed cover" procedure. The reasoning and the conclusion of the tribunal are unexceptionable. The only question for our consideration is whether in the facts and circumstances of this case specially in view of the events subsequent to the meeting of the DPC, it would be in the interest of justice to promote respondent Syed to the post of Chief Engineer.
